When it comes to designing heating systems for buildings, accurately calculating heat loss is crucial This information helps determine the appropriate size of heating equipment needed to keep a building at a comfortable temperature without wasting energy One tool that is commonly used for this purpose is the BS EN 12831 heat loss calculator.
BS EN 12831 is a European standard that provides guidelines for calculating the heat loss of buildings The standard takes into account factors such as the thermal properties of building materials, the insulation levels of the building envelope, and the design of the heating system By using a heat loss calculator that complies with BS EN 12831, engineers and designers can ensure that their calculations are accurate and reliable.
One of the key benefits of using a BS EN 12831 heat loss calculator is that it provides a systematic approach to calculating heat loss The calculator takes into account all relevant factors that can affect heat loss, including the size and shape of the building, the type of construction materials used, and the climate conditions in which the building is located By inputting this information into the calculator, users can obtain a precise estimate of the heat loss for a given building.
Another advantage of using a BS EN 12831 heat loss calculator is that it can help designers optimize the energy efficiency of a building By accurately calculating heat loss, designers can determine the most efficient way to heat a building, such as by improving insulation, reducing air leakage, or installing energy-efficient heating equipment This can not only save energy and reduce heating costs but also contribute to reducing the building’s carbon footprint.

On the other hand, if a system is oversized, it may cycle on and off frequently, wasting energy and reducing the lifespan of the equipment By using a heat loss calculator, designers can determine the correct size of heating equipment needed to maintain a consistent and comfortable temperature in a building.
Furthermore, using a BS EN 12831 heat loss calculator can also help designers comply with building regulations Many countries have strict regulations that require buildings to meet certain energy efficiency standards By using a calculator that complies with a recognized standard such as BS EN 12831, designers can ensure that their calculations are accurate and meet the required standards This can help streamline the process of obtaining building permits and approvals, as well as ensure that the building is in compliance with the law.
